- You may not be able to get the total number into normal range with exercise alone. A lot of this is genetic. You might however be able to get the LDL-HDL ratio fixed. We're not talking about 3 days a week for 30 minutes nonsense, though. A friend of mine did it, but in the process worked up to 15 hours a week of swimming, cycling and running, and took his body fat down to about 6%. He got everything to a level were the doc said he could hold off on the drugs, for now anyway.

A) Non-modifiable risk factors: * Increasing Age. *Gender. *Heredity(including Race) Mogifiable Risk factors: *Smoking. *High bloog cholestrol. *High blood pressure. *physical inactivity. *Obesity. *Diabetes mellitus. *Stress. *Alcohol.
